    I was in the area attending a cheese event at Murray's and wanted to find a place for dinner. Found Ferdi through the Seated app. I was glad that our timing was perfect to take advantage of the early dinner price fix menu that is even a better deal than restaurant week. 3 courses for $30! It even included steak without a surcharge. Mussels were a good size and arrived with all shells open. The white wine garlic and tomato broth had a steady garlic level that went well with the mussels themselves. The steak was a shell steak that was tender and seasoned perfectly. It was accompanied by a flavorful mix of shiitake mushrooms, peppers and roasted potatoes. The included dessert was a simple but satisfying scoop of vanilla gelato with sliced strawberries and a biscotti. The aperitivo happy hour was also in effect so I got an elderflower spritz that was sweet and refreshing. Service was excellent and not intrusive. I'll definitely return for another early dinner. The value is excellent for the quality and quantity of food that you get. They also take part in several cash back dining programs like upside, Frankie and blackbird which even brings more value to the meal.

    Stopped by for an early dinner on a Sunday evening. They got us in right away as we were the only table for a quite a while. Service across the board was pretty decent. The restaurant is cozy and warm with some interesting design elements throughout that don't necessarily fit in. Sun - Thur, there's a 3 course prix fixe menu that we decided to try. I'm always a fan of trying many different items instead of going all in on one or two. However, the food was largely underwhelming. The appetizers are a bit hit and miss. The arancini were bland but the tomato sauce helped to complement. The stuffed mushrooms have a decent flavor but they're on the soggier side. For the entrees, the chicken Milanese was a small piece of breaded chicken under arugula, tomatoes, and mozzarella. The tuna livornese was possible one of the saltiest dishes I've ever had. Desert was certainly the highlight as the tiramisu was nicely balanced between cream, coffee, and lady fingers.
